Tourism N4-N6
The Tourism N4-N6 program is a nationally accredited qualification designed to prepare students for rewarding careers in the vibrant and fast-growing tourism industry. This program is made up of three levels—N4, N5, and N6, each normally taking around six months to complete, resulting in a total of 18 months of theoretical study. Throughout these levels, students gain both essential knowledge and practical skills related to key areas like popular tourist destinations, travel services, tourism communication, and travel office procedures. Students taking this program develop important competencies such as customer service excellence, handling reservations, planning travel itineraries, and understanding the legal and business aspects that impact the tourism sector.
Along the way, the course also encourages the growth of personal attributes crucial for success in tourism, including strong communication skills, the ability to interact well with others, and a genuine passion for travel and exploration. To enter the program, applicants must have completed Grade 12 or hold an equivalent qualification. In addition, students need to demonstrate a good level of proficiency in English, as much of the coursework and communication is conducted in this language. After successfully finishing the N4, N5, and N6 certificates, students are required to complete an 18-month hands-on internship within the industry. This practical experience is essential for qualifying for the National Diploma in Tourism.
Holding this diploma significantly improves employment opportunities in a wide range of jobs such as travel consultants, tour operators, hotel receptionists, and airline ground staff, among others. Duration
- Each level takes six months full-time to complete.
- A total of 18 months to complete the theoretical components (N4, N5, and N6).
- Each level consists of four subjects. On completion of a level, a student is awarded a certificate
- 18 months’ practical experience in the work environment (in-service training)
- It takes a minimum of three years to qualify for a National N Diploma
Tourism N4-N6 Subjects
N4 Certificate
- Tourist Destinations
- Travel Services
- Tourism Communications
- Travel Office Procedures
N5 Certificate
- Tourist Destinations
- Travel Services
- Tourism Communications
- Travel Office Procedures
N6 Certificate
- Tourist Destinations
- Travel Services
- Travel Office Procedures
- Hotel Receptionist
